Your Tasks
- Be the go-to problem solver for customers by handling inquiries via chat, email and phone with confidence and care.
- Turn challenges into solutions by troubleshooting issues quickly and delivering accurate, timely answers.
- Create meaningful connections with customers and build relationships that last.
- Work hand-in-hand with internal teams to ensure every case is resolved smoothly and efficiently.
- Keep things organized and transparent by maintaining clear, accurate records of all interactions.
- Spot opportunities for improvement by identifying recurring issues and helping shape better processes and a smarter knowledge base.
Your Profile
- Language talent - fluent in German, ready to connect and communicate with confidence and clarity.
- Confident communicator in English, ensuring smooth collaboration in an international environment.
- Natural problem-solver who loves turning challenges into solutions and thrives in a fast-paced environment.
- Someone who cares about people and enjoys building strong, positive relationships with customers.
- Tech-savvy and organized, comfortable using Excel and Microsoft Office to keep things running smoothly.
- Driven by growth and learning, eager to develop in an international setting and take on new responsibilities.
What You'll Love About Working Here
- Practical benefits: private medical care with Medicover with additional packages (e.g., dental, senior care, oncology) available on preferential terms, life insurance and 40+ options on our NAIS benefit platform, including Netflix, Spotify or Sports card.
- Enjoy hybrid working model that fits your life - after completing onboarding, connect work from a modern office with ergonomic work from home, thanks to home office package (including laptop, monitor, and chair). Ask your recruiter about the details.
- Early support thanks to Buddy Programs: learn in the flow of work alongside our experts who collaborate on top-tier solutions for global enterprises, including 145 Fortune 500 companies.
- Access to over 70 training tracks with certification opportunities (e.g., GenAI, Excel, Business Analysis, Project Management) on our NEXT platform. Build your development path through internal mobility, mentoring, professional communities, and close support from a People Manager.
We don’t require professional experience. You will be working among experts, where willingness to learn new things is supported by a wide range of trainings designed to improve your skills.

About Capgemini
Capgemini is an AI-powered global business and technology transformation partner, delivering tangible business value. We imagine the future of organizations and make it real with AI, technology and people. With our strong heritage of nearly 60 years, we are a responsible and diverse group of over 420,000 team members in more than 50 countries. We deliver end-to-end services and solutions with our deep industry expertise and strong partner ecosystem, leveraging our capabilities across strategy, technology, design, engineering and business operations. The Group reported 2025 global revenues of €22.5 billion.
